What’s the flower of hope?

Iris. The iris (Iris xiphium) symbolizes hope, cherished friendship and valor and is the inspiration for the fleur-de-lis.

What does a peony symbolize?

The Peony represents compassion and bashfulness. It can also be used to portray shame or indignation. The Peony flower can also symbolize a happy life, happy marriage, good health, and prosperity. Poppies are a symbol of sleep, peace, and death.

What do flowers symbolize in Victorian England?

Nearly every sentiment imaginable can be expressed with flowers. The orange blossom, for instance, means chastity, purity, and loveliness, while the red chrysanthemum means “I love you.” Flowery Language of the Victorian Era Learning the special symbolism of flowers became a popular pastime during the 1800s.

Why is the flower Paeon pink and red?

This pink and red flower is thought to be named after Paeon, the Greek physician of the gods. Paeon, a student of Asclepius, the Greek god of healing and medicine, inspired jealousy in his teacher. To keep him safe from being killed, Zeus transformed Paeon into the beautiful flower—one that is revered for its healing properties.
